- Reducing Stress and Anxiety:
Regular meditation practice helps
calm the mind, allowing individuals to detach from racing thoughts and worries.
By focusing on the present moment, meditation promotes relaxation and activates
the body's natural relaxation response, thereby reducing stress hormone levels
and alleviating anxiety symptoms.
- Enhancing Emotional Well-being:
Meditation cultivates emotional
well-being by increasing self-awareness and emotional resilience. Through
meditation, individuals learn to observe their thoughts and emotions without
judgment. This practice fosters a better understanding of one's emotional
patterns and triggers, enabling individuals to respond to situations more
mindfully rather than reacting impulsively. As a result, meditation helps
regulate emotions, promotes emotional stability, and enhances overall emotional
well-being.
- Improving Concentration and Focus:
Regular meditation practice has been shown to
improve concentration and focus. By training the mind to stay present and
focused on a chosen object of attention, such as the breath or a mantra,
meditation strengthens the ability to sustain concentration in daily
activities. This enhanced focus can positively impact productivity,
performance, and overall cognitive function.
- Boosting Mental Clarity and
Creativity:
Meditation enhances mental clarity
by quieting the mind's chatter and reducing mental clutter. As the mind becomes
more settled and centered through meditation, individuals experience increased
clarity in their thoughts and decision-making processes. Moreover, meditation
has been found to stimulate the brain's creative centers, leading to improved
problem-solving abilities and enhanced creativity.
- Promoting Physical Health:
Beyond its mental and emotional
benefits, meditation also contributes to improved physical health. The practice
has been linked to lower blood pressure, reduced inflammation, and enhanced
immune function. Regular meditation can also support healthy sleep patterns, as
it helps calm the mind and induces relaxation, making it an effective natural
remedy for insomnia and other sleep disorders.
- Managing Chronic Pain:
Meditation has shown promising
results in managing chronic pain conditions. By directing attention away from
pain sensations and cultivating a non-judgmental attitude towards discomfort,
meditation can help individuals develop a greater tolerance for pain and reduce
its impact on daily life. Additionally, meditation's relaxation effects can
alleviate muscle tension, further contributing to pain relief.
- Cultivating Compassion and Kindness:
Meditation practices often involve cultivating
compassion and kindness towards oneself and others. Through techniques like
loving-kindness meditation, individuals develop a sense of empathy and
understanding, leading to more harmonious relationships and a greater sense of
connectedness with others. This cultivation of compassion extends not only to
people but also to the environment and all living beings.
